Output e54d8fbaf84e473eb1d99335ebe8966bc4b19b30090d455e36f957f824197621:2

value
14764991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 550e2f27ec5944deda37892f6f4c96e675ebf4d7 OP_EQUAL
address
39SkMPHWw5DT6aD9rqMFzuxcZ5eahhE6ya
transaction
e54d8fbaf84e473eb1d99335ebe8966bc4b19b30090d455e36f957f824197621
spent
true